Title: Gurley & Smith Lake

Distance: 32 miles 

Start Location:Gurley City Park, NEXT to the library (Library address is 225 Walker St, Gurley)

Date & Start Time: Saturday, 11 Nov, 12:30 PM

Ride Leader: Hunter Chockley, chockleyj@bellsouth.net, 256 527-8643

Description:This ride will be a moderate ride of 33 miles that includes doing multiple climbs in Gurley and Smith Lake Loop. There is no major climb. Itwill bea scenic ride including a fly-by of Smith Lake. The cumulative climb for the route is ~1330 ft and an overall average pace of 15 mph ish (due to the climbing).

Rest Stop at ~18 miles (Maysville Store)

The cue sheet and map link follows: https://ridewithgps.com/routes/26470007. This route is listed on the SCCC RWGPS Club Account.

Bring a cue sheet and map and have the phone number of the Ride Leader and the phone number of at least one friend. 

Again, this ride has a bunch of hills but No major climb so be sure you can do the distance at the stated average pace. If you choose to ride at a much faster pace than the Ride Leader or deviate from the route, thenyou are on your own.
